Back in Loading a 32-bit library via DynaLoader into 64-bit Perl 5.8.8 on HP-UX 11i, I found that I needed to recompile my Perl 5.8.8 in 32-bit mode due to an API library that I need only being available as a precompiled wrapper to an application we use only being available in 32-bit mode.

I have the 32-bit version of gcc 3.4.5 (from the hp development center), but the Configure script in the Perl distribution is forcing the lp64 flag to the compiler, which isn't recognized as a valid flag under the 32-bit version.

Any idea what flags I need to pass to configure to force 32-bit mode on this platform?
